Definitions of passive:

  • noun:   the voice used to indicate that the grammatical subject of the verb is the recipient (not the source) of the action denoted by the verb
    Example: "`The ball was thrown by the boy' uses the passive voice"
  • adjective:   peacefully resistant in response to injustice
    Example: "Passive resistance"
  • adjective:   lacking in energy or will
    Example: "Much benevolence of the passive order may be traced to a disinclination to inflict pain upon oneself- George Meredith"
  • adjective:   expressing thatthe subject of the sentence is the patient of the action denoted by the verb
    Example: "Academics seem to favor passive sentences"
